Hello, I am writing this message through google translate. I have a Motorola Flipout MB511. It can receive calls and texts (sim card unlocked) but I can't register with Motoblur so I can't use my phone. Nothing further on the registration screen is used (assuming calls can be received). I have tried many different sides but nothing has worked so far. My phone is from AT&T.


When trying to register, it gives an error with a connection problem with the server (WiFi is on)

On the setup screen, hold "Alt" and press the "E" key twice, then let go of the "Alt" key and type "bluroff" and then wait. It should exit setup mode to the home screen.

Im wondering the same thing about the AT&T model, not as straightforward as typing a code on the setup screen or flashing deblur global rom(which just doesn't work on the AT&T model, already tried it myself-bricks the phone until you flash AT&T firmware again). Maybe we can somehow decompile the AT&T stock rom file and edit that build.prop line which disables blur? Would be absurd to need a mainboard replacement to a global/non-AT&T board, for such a stupid issue...
